This position is located at Bureau of Engraving and Printing, within the External Affairs Division DCF. As a PUBLIC AFFAIRS SPECIALIST, you will research, analyze, and respond to numerous queries via telephone, visits, mail or the website and coordinate replies regarding the Bureau's products, programs, and policies as applicable.

Duties

As a PUBLIC AFFAIRS SPECIALIST, you will: - Identify restrictions on data requested and refer more complex requests to program officials. - Formulate responses to Congressional as well as general inquiries by researching the specific issue. - Moderate web platforms such as the BEP Discussion Forum and Contact Us area of the public website. - Write and/or edit news releases, employee communications, website content, social media content, and other informational materials related to Bureau history, programs, operations, and products for dissemination to internal and external customers. - Coordinate and organize news media interviews with Bureau officials and corresponds with various private and Federal sector representatives.

Qualifications

You must meet the following requirements by the closing date of this announcement. Specialized Experience for the GS-12: Specialized Experience is defined as one year of experience at the GS-11 level, or equivalent, that is directly related to the position, and which has equipped the candidate with the particular knowledge, skills, and abilities to successfully perform the duties of the position. Specialized experience for this position includes: - Collecting, assembling, preparing, and disseminating information concerning the various programs of the organization. AND - Independently planning and promoting programs by coordinating events, with the purpose of educating the public and internal workforce on product and mission. Specialized Experience for the GS-11: Specialized Experience is defined as one year of experience at the GS-9 level, or equivalent, that is directly related to the position, and which has equipped the candidate with the particular knowledge, skills, and abilities to successfully perform the duties of the position. Specialized experience for this position includes: - Developing communications for public and/or internal consumption. OR You may substitute education for specialized experience as follows: Ph.D. or equivalent doctoral degree. OR 3 full years of progressively higher-level graduate education leading to such a degree. OR LL.M., if related. OR You may qualify by a combination of experience and education. Only graduate level education in excess of the first 36 semester hours (54 quarter hours) may be combined to be considered for qualifying education. In addition to the above requirements, you must meet the following time-in-grade requirement, if applicable: For the GS-12, you must have been at the GS-11level for 52 weeks. For the GS-11, you must have been at the GS-9level for 52 weeks.
